WebAt Velosi, fitness for service assessments are usually measurable engineering appraisals that are conducted to demonstrate the structural integrity of an in-service component that may comprise a flaw or damage. Our FFS assessments are performed in compliance with international standards such as ASME B31G, BS 7910, API 579-1/ASME FFS-1 etc.
